Mysuru Additional Deputy Commissioner (ADC) P Shivaraju has issued directives for an urgent survey of lakes in the district and the eviction of all encroachments. The decision was taken during a high-level meeting held at the deputy commissioner's office on Thursday.
Meeting Highlights
The meeting was attended by key officials including the Deputy Director of Land Records (DDLR), Tahsildars from various taluks, and representatives from the Environment and Water Resources departments. The ADC emphasized the need for immediate action to protect water bodies from illegal occupation.
Survey and Eviction Plan
According to officials, the survey will cover all major and minor lakes in Mysuru district. Encroachments identified during the survey will be removed without delay. The ADC has instructed the revenue and water resources departments to coordinate closely to ensure the process is completed within a stipulated timeframe.
This move comes amid growing concerns over the shrinking of lake boundaries due to unauthorized constructions and agricultural activities. The district administration aims to restore the original boundaries of lakes to prevent flooding and preserve the ecosystem.
Further details regarding the timeline and specific areas to be covered are expected to be released soon. The ADC has also sought a progress report from all tahsildars within a week.
